March 22, 2014 · 2013-14 · Postseason
01/Box score
23 players
Postseason
Postseason
NORTH DAKOTA STATE · 12 players
| Player | POS | GS | MIN | PTS | REB | OR | DR | AST | STL | BLK | TO | PF | FG | 3P | FT |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Kory Brown | Guard | GS | 38 | 13 | 4 | 2 | 2 | 1 | 1 | 2 | 0 | 3 | 4-7 | 1-1 | 4-4 |
| Marshall Bjorklund | Forward | GS | 31 | 8 | 1 | 0 | 1 | 1 | 0 | 0 | 3 | 2 | 3-7 | 0-0 | 2-3 |
| Taylor Braun | Guard | GS | 37 | 7 | 5 | 0 | 5 | 1 | 0 | 0 | 1 | 3 | 2-14 | 0-3 | 3-4 |
| TrayVonn Wright | Forward | GS | 20 | 4 | 5 | 1 | 4 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 1 | 4 | 2-4 | 0-1 | 0-0 |
| Lawrence Alexander | Guard | GS | 38 | 3 | 3 | 0 | 3 | 2 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 3 | 1-8 | 1-5 | 0-0 |
| Chris Kading | Forward | — | 20 | 4 | 3 | 1 | 2 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 1 | 1-4 | 0-1 | 2-2 |
| Jordan Aaberg | Forward | — | 7 | 2 | 2 | 2 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 1 | 0 | 1-2 | 0-0 | 0-0 |
| Carlin Dupree | Guard | — | 4 | 2 | 1 | 0 | 1 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 1-1 | 0-0 | 0-1 |
| Dexter Werner | Forward | — | 1 | 1 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0-0 | 0-0 | 1-2 |
| Zach Checkal | Guard | — | 1 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0-0 | 0-0 | 0-0 |
| Mike Felt | Guard | — | 2 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 1 | 0-0 | 0-0 | 0-1 |
| Fred Newell | Guard | — | 1 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0-0 | 0-0 | 0-0 |
| TEAM | — | — | 200 | 44 | 24 | 6 | 18 | 5 | 1 | 2 | 6 | — | 15-47 · 31.9% | 2-11 · 18.2% | 12-17 · 70.6% |
SAN DIEGO STATE · 11 players
| Player | POS | GS | MIN | PTS | REB | OR | DR | AST | STL | BLK | TO | PF | FG | 3P | FT |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Xavier Thames | Guard | GS | 35 | 30 | 1 | 0 | 1 | 5 | 1 | 0 | 3 | 1 | 9-19 | 4-9 | 8-9 |
| Josh Davis | Forward | GS | 34 | 6 | 13 | 3 | 10 | 2 | 2 | 1 | 1 | 3 | 2-4 | 0-0 | 2-5 |
| J.J. O'Brien | Forward | GS | 30 | 4 | 5 | 1 | 4 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 1 | 1 | 1-2 | 0-0 | 2-2 |
| Winston Shepard | Forward | GS | 15 | 3 | 1 | 0 | 1 | 1 | 0 | 0 | 1 | 1 | 1-6 | 0-1 | 1-2 |
| Skylar Spencer | Forward | GS | 27 | 0 | 4 | 1 | 3 | 0 | 0 | 1 | 0 | 4 | 0-1 | 0-0 | 0-0 |
| Dwayne Polee II | Forward | — | 30 | 15 | 6 | 0 | 6 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 2 | 4-8 | 2-4 | 5-6 |
| Aqeel Quinn | Guard | — | 12 | 5 | 2 | 0 | 2 | 0 | 1 | 0 | 0 | 3 | 2-3 | 1-1 | 0-0 |
| Matt Shrigley | Forward | — | 14 | 0 | 3 | 1 | 2 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0-1 | 0-1 | 0-0 |
| Dakarai Allen | Guard | — | 1 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 1 | 0-0 | 0-0 | 0-0 |
| D'Erryl Williams | Guard | — | 1 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0-0 | 0-0 | 0-0 |
| James Johnson | Forward | — | 1 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0-0 | 0-0 | 0-0 |
| TEAM | — | — | 200 | 63 | 35 | 6 | 29 | 8 | 4 | 2 | 6 | — | 19-44 · 43.2% | 7-16 · 43.8% | 18-24 · 75.0% |
